Wanted Marine seen in Mexico, cousin says
Wanted Marine seen in Mexico, cousin says
By Guillermo Arias - The Associated Press
Posted : Wednesday Jan 23, 2008 8:11:52 EST

GUADALAJARA, Mexico — Missing Marine Cpl. Cesar Laurean, wanted in the slaying of a pregnant colleague, visited relatives in Mexico last week but left without saying where he was headed, a man identified as his cousin said Tuesday.

Juan Antonio Ramos Ramirez said Laurean walked into his liquor store last Monday or Tuesday and the two cousins chatted for 10 minutes about their families. Laurean then told Ramos Ramirez that he had to get back to two friends outside, but he might return. He never came back.

CNN first reported Tuesday that Laurean had briefly stopped by Ramos Ramirez’s liquor store in Zapopan, just outside Guadalajara.

Days later, Ramos Ramirez saw a television report that Laurean was wanted in the U.S. in the death of 20-year-old Lance Cpl. Maria Lauterbach.

“We were completely shocked,” he said.
